    I am as country as cornbread we eat very simple.


    Chicken is cheap. I buy the large bag of unbreaded chicken tenders I thaw them all. I line them all up on the baking sheet and season them as many ways as I have in my spice cabinet. Bake till done. I let them cool. Then put the whole sheet in the freezer. then when frozen I place them in a gallon bag. Then I can just get out 3 or four and heat them up.
    Beans are great they are cheap and good for you. I buy the store brand california veggies for a quick and easy side dish.
